Foxtable(狐表)用户栏目专家坐堂 → 帮助 父表与子表同步加载 中的代码是否有误?


  共有8096人关注过本帖树形打印复制链接

主题:帮助 父表与子表同步加载 中的代码是否有误?

帅哥哟,离线,有人找我吗?
xuezxz
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:427 积分:4529 威望:0 精华:0 注册:2012/3/7 23:19:00
帮助 父表与子表同步加载 中的代码是否有误?  发帖心情 Post By:2013/2/19 17:49:00 [只看该作者]

原代码执行报错

If DataTables("订单").DataRows.Count = 0 Then '如果订单表没有数据
    DataTables(
"订单明细").LoadFilter = "订单ID Is Null" '不加载订单明细
Else
    Dim 
ids As String
    For Each 
dr As DataRow In DataTables("订单").DataRows
        
ids = ids & "," & dr("订单ID")
    Next
    
idsids.Trim(",")
    DataTables(
"订单明细").LoadFilter = "订单ID In (" & ids & ")"
End If
DataTables(
"订单明细").Load()

 

红字部分改后通过,是不是帮助上的代码错了?

If DataTables("订单").DataRows.Count = 0 Then '如果订单表没有数据
    DataTables(
"订单明细").LoadFilter = "订单ID Is Null" '不加载订单明细
Else
    Dim 
ids As String
    For Each 
dr As DataRow In DataTables("订单").DataRows
        
ids = ids & "," & "'" & dr("订单ID") & "'"
    Next
    
idsids.Trim(",")
    DataTables(
"订单明细").LoadFilter = "订单ID In (" & ids & ")"
End If
DataTables(
"订单明细").Load()

 


 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2013/2/19 18:14:00 [只看该作者]

 具体情况而定,如果你的订单ID是数值类型的话,就不需要单引号。

 如果是字符类型的话,就需要单引号。

 回到顶部
帅哥哟,离线,有人找我吗?
布莱克朱
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:623 积分:3897 威望:0 精华:0 注册:2011/8/3 22:13:00
  发帖心情 Post By:2013/2/19 19:12:00 [只看该作者]

帮助是数值型的写法   
字符型的代码写法同 2   
老大,是否帮助需要说明下?
[此贴子已经被作者于2013-2-19 19:12:41编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
泡泡
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:小狐 帖子:316 积分:2628 威望:0 精华:0 注册:2013/3/4 20:21:00
  发帖心情 Post By:2013/3/13 14:47:00 [只看该作者]

我今天花了一上午看这里,代码总是报错

原来是有这么个情况

希望官方在说明里做修订


 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47497 积分:251403 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2013/3/13 14:54:00 [只看该作者]

呵呵,其实帮助不止一个地方提到的,但是没有办法每次用in的时候,都说一下啊

 回到顶部
帅哥哟,离线,有人找我吗?
泡泡
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:小狐 帖子:316 积分:2628 威望:0 精华:0 注册:2013/3/4 20:21:00
  发帖心情 Post By:2013/3/13 14:57:00 [只看该作者]

看这大段代码的人 多是想依葫芦画瓢的初学者吧

基本没能力辨识里面不周全的代码的


 回到顶部